Another Trail area resident has fallen victim to a scam artist.
Trail RCMP say the woman was duped out of $10,000 by someone posing as a bank security officer.
She was instructed to send gift cards as part of their phony investigation and he stayed on the phone with the victimized woman until the transaction was complete.
RCMP say she called her financial institutions once learning it was a fraud, but Trail Detachment Commander Mike Wicentowich says the money is gone.
“Please do not purchase gift cards and send the information on the cards to anyone over the phone,” he warned.
“The money is not recoverable nor protected from your bank insurance,” added Wicentowich.
